We are looking for an experienced corporate attorney to join our growing legal team!

As a Senior Counsel, Corporate, Securities & M&A, you'll partner with and advise multiple cross-functional teams including Investor Relations, Financial Reporting, Corporate Development, Internal Audit, Stock Administration, Accounting, Tax, and Treasury teams on a wide range of corporate legal projects. The successful candidate will be a resourceful self-starter, comfortable working in a fast-paced and dynamic environment and excellent at building strong relationships. This role is an exciting new position that will play an important role in Reddit's continued growth and success.

This position will report to the Deputy General Counsel, Corporate.

Location: Any of Reddit's U.S. offices (SF, LA, Chicago, NYC) or remotely from within the U.S

Responsibilities:

  • Work with members of the legal team and cross-functional stakeholders on various corporate matters including SEC disclosures (including registration, proxy, and periodic filings), stakeholder engagement, international expansion, and equity administration.
  • Provide support for capital markets and other strategic transactions, including M&A, corporate venture investments, corporate financing transactions, and related workstreams.
  • Assist in drafting and reviewing other public disclosures and corporate communications, including earnings releases, press releases, and blog posts.
  • Support stock administration on equity matters and employee education.
  • Stay current on securities law and corporate governance trends and best practices and SEC and stock exchange developments, including new rules and regulations or benchmarking projects.
  • Shape and improve legal processes to enable both legal and business functions to scale effectively.

Required Qualifications:

  • JD degree from an accredited US law school and a member in good standing of a state Bar.
  • 7-10 years of corporate, M&A, and securities law experience at a large, tech-focused law firm, with some in-house experience preferred.
  • Expertise in corporate, securities, investments, and other corporate transactions.
  • Pragmatic strategist capable of operating independently who can identify and resolve legal issues in the context of the company's commercial goals and risk thresholds.
  • Must be able to provide crisp, timely, and pragmatic legal advice.
  • Collaborative team player with excellent interpersonal skills and a good sense of humor.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Flexible and able to organize, prioritize and complete multiple priorities and projects (internally and externally) in a fast-paced environment.
  • Ability to learn quickly and take on challenging new projects with enthusiasm.
  • Excellent judgment, attention to detail, and ability to handle sensitive and confidential information.
